MAX3223EUP+ Frequently Asked Questions (FAQs)

  • The MAX3223EUP+ requires careful layout and placement to ensure proper operation. It's recommended to place the device close to the UART interface, use short traces, and avoid routing signals under the device. A solid ground plane and decoupling capacitors are also essential. Refer to the application note AN-1149 for more details.
  • The SHDN pin should be connected to a logic-level input or a pull-up resistor to VCC. When SHDN is low, the device enters shutdown mode, reducing power consumption. When SHDN is high, the device is enabled. It's recommended to use a pull-up resistor to ensure the device is enabled during power-up.
  • The MAX3223EUP+ supports data rates up to 1Mbps, making it suitable for high-speed UART applications. However, the actual data rate may be limited by the system's clock frequency, signal quality, and other factors.
  • Yes, the MAX3223EUP+ can be used in multi-point or multi-drop configurations. However, it's essential to ensure that the total bus capacitance does not exceed the recommended maximum value of 250pF. Exceeding this value may affect signal integrity and reliability.
  • The MAX3223EUP+ has built-in ESD protection, but it's still recommended to follow proper ESD handling procedures during assembly and testing. Use an ESD wrist strap, mat, or workstation to prevent damage to the device.
